FastReport 数据库

怎么用FastReport打印数据库图片

小亿
344
2023-11-02 13:21:52
栏目: 大数据
亿速云数据库,弹性扩容,低至0.3元/天! 查看>>

在FastReport中打印数据库图片,可以按照以下步骤进行操作:

  1. 在FastReport中创建一个新的报表。
  2. 在报表的数据源中添加一个数据库连接,连接到存储图片的数据库表。
  3. 在报表中添加一个图片控件,用于显示数据库中的图片。
  4. 在图片控件的DataSet属性中选择刚刚添加的数据库连接。
  5. 在图片控件的Expression属性中填写获取图片的字段名。
  6. 运行报表,即可在图片控件中显示数据库中的图片。

需要注意的是,数据库中存储的图片字段类型通常为BLOB或者VARBINARY,在FastReport中需要将该字段的数据类型设置为"Image",才能正确显示图片。

另外,如果数据库中存储的是图片的文件路径而非图片本身,可以通过在Expression属性中使用相应的代码来获取图片路径并显示图片。例如,可以使用类似"file://" + 数据库字段名的表达式来指定图片路径。

亿速云「云数据库 MySQL」免部署即开即用,比自行安装部署数据库高出1倍以上的性能,双节点冗余防止单节点故障,数据自动定期备份随时恢复。点击查看>>

相关推荐:FastReport2.5 打印数据库blob图片

0
看了该问题的人还看了